Question

which of the following has the greatest number of unshared electrons around the central atom?
nh₄⁺
ch₄
clf₃
bcl₃
icl₅

Explanation:

Brief Explanations
  • For $\text{NH}_4^+$: Central N has 0 unshared electrons (4 bonds, no lone pairs).
  • For $\text{CH}_4$: Central C has 0 unshared electrons (4 bonds, no lone pairs).
  • For $\text{ClF}_3$: Central Cl has 4 unshared electrons (2 lone pairs: $2\times2=4$).
  • For $\text{BCl}_3$: Central B has 0 unshared electrons (3 bonds, no lone pairs).
  • For $\text{ICl}_5$: Central I has 2 unshared electrons (1 lone pair: $1\times2=2$).

Answer:

CIF₃ (Note: Assuming the option label is a typo for ClF₃, which is the correct formula with the most unshared electrons)
